Women's Soccer to Host Lewis on Friday, UIndy for Senior Day

10/5/2022 11:44:00 AM

LIBERTY, Mo. - The William Jewell women's soccer team returns home for the final time this season to host Lewis University on Friday evening followed by Indianapolis on Sunday afternoon.
vs. Lewis Friday, October 7 | 5 p.m. | Greene Stadium

vs. UIndy (Senior Day) Sunday, October 9 | 12 p.m. | Greene Stadium

THE SERIES
  • Jewell has seen success against Lewis in the NCAA era, going 5-7 since 2011, but have dropped the last four. Despite two early goals last season, the Cardinals fell 5-2. 
  • The Cardinals are 3-7-1 against the strong program at Indianapolis but are looking for their first win since 2015 after dropping a 4-0 decision last year. 

CARDINAL NOTES
  • Corrine Hughes continues to rank among the best scorers in the league, sitting second with six goals and 13 total points this season. Her six scores is tied for fifth in a single season in the NCAA era and marks the most by a Cardinal since 2018. 
  • Kate Lawrence is one of nine players across the GLVC to boast three assists this season and lead the league. The Cardinals nine assists are fourth most amongst league teams. 
  • Katie Wagenheim is third in the conference with 39 total saves this season while Emily Glassman made her season debut last weekend after recovering from injury and posted a career best 14 stops against McKendree. As a team, Jewell leads the GLVC with 7.82 saves per game. 
  • The offense has improved from last year as the Cardinals have already surpassed season totals in goals (11) and shots on goal (55) and are closing in on the total shots number from 2021 already attempting 109 this fall. 
  • On Sunday, the Cardinals will honor six seniors including including Hughes, Wagenheim, Paige Liston, Jayme Coon, Caroline Staebell and Carolyn Schneck during Senior Day festivities which will take place between the men's and women's contests.
